NEW LISTING -- CONTEMPORARY and POWERFUL WORSHIP BALLADS a la "We Cry Out" Jeremy Camp, "You Are Everything" by Matthew West, "I Can Only Imagine" by MercyMe, etc., are needed by the Creative Executive at a Major Music Publishing company for an established and well-respected Male Christian Artist. They need STRONG and EMOTIONAL worship-based lyrics, with BIG lyrical HOOKS, and HUGE CHORUSES. A WELL-CRAFTED lyric and SONG STRUCTURE are SUPER IMPORTANT! Everything from ballads to up-tempos are welcome but melody and lyric style must be current and commercially competitive in the Christian market. Vocal and instrumental demo presentation must effectively put across the essence of your song! Please submit one to three songs per CD or online, include lyrics. All submissions will be screened and critiqued by TAXI and must be received no later than Wednesday, March 21, 2012.
TAXI # S120321WB
